二次贝塞尔曲线CanvasRenderingContext2D.quadraticCurveTo() 是 Canvas 2D API 新增二次贝塞尔曲线路径的方法。它需要2个点。 第一个点是控制点,第二个点是终点。其中需要注意的是起点就是我们通过moveTo来定义的。void ctx.quadraticCurveTo(cpx, cpy, x, y);cpx:控制点的x坐标cpy:控制点的y坐标x:
# Java画图网站:从基础到实际应用 随着互联网技术的发展,越来越多的网站开始使用图形化界面吸引用户。在这些网站中,Java作为一种强大的编程语言,常用于生成和处理图形。不论是简单的图表还是复杂的图形,Java都有提供相应的支持。本篇文章将介绍如何使用Java绘制图形,并用代码示例来说明其具体实现。 ## 基础知识 Java绘图主要依赖于`java.awt`和`javax.swing`这两
原创 9月前
29阅读
1.gallery.pyecharts.org 2.seaborn.pydata.org 3.pyecharts.org 4.echarts.apache.org 5.matplotlib.org ...
转载 2021-10-10 13:53:00
1503阅读
2评论
一、使用Rstudio      切记Rstudio安装之前要先安装R,否则会报错   进入Rstudio官网http://www.rstudio.com/  点击DownloadRStudio   点击下载桌面,免费的  然后直接安装即可   二、如何使用R画图&nb
转载 2023-09-18 03:20:34
143阅读
Python绘制图形库turtle1.介绍: turtle库根据一组函数指令的控制,在平面坐标系中移动,从而它爬行的路径上绘制图形。 2.原理:turtle(海龟)由程序控制在画布上游走,走过的轨迹形成绘制的图形,可以变换海龟的颜色和宽度等,这里海龟即画笔。 1、turtle的绘图窗体布局绘图窗体,在操作系统上表现为一个窗口,是turtle的一个画布空间。 窗口中最小单位是像素。例如:绘制一个10
public static void main(String[] args) { try { /** * 得到图片缓冲区 * INT精确度达到一定,RGB三原色,高度280,宽度360 */ BufferedImage bi = new BufferedI
转载 2023-06-07 16:32:51
157阅读
今天是写博客的第一天,今天学习的内容是如何用Java编程语言绘图。具体步骤如下:(1)在JPanel上画图(圆形,方形,大小等)。步骤一:定义一个类MyPanel继承JPanel。步骤二:调用父类函数完成初始化,复写JPanel类里面的paint函数,将Graphics的实例对象作为参数传入。步骤三:调用Graphics类的方法(形状,颜色,大小)。(2)添加到JFrame步骤一:继承JFrame
转载 2023-05-23 22:07:00
277阅读
前言大家画流程图,架构图都用什么呢?之前画图用的不同的软件安装到电脑上,比如微软的Visio 画甘特图各种图也都能画,但是不免费不香。然后有用了ProcessOn这个也是挺好用的,就是免费的图有点少,后来通过多方寻找,发现了一个类似于ProcessOn而且完全免费的网站
原创 2022-02-18 17:11:38
235阅读
//图形接口 packageCbs;//图形集合 public interfaceNetJavaShape {public abstract voiddraw(); }//直线类 packageCbs;importjava.awt.Color;importjava.awt.Graphics;importCbs.NetJavaShape;public class ImpLine implements
    Java偏向于图形化界面编程,当然就有图像显示之类的东西,图形处理方面也是强项。1、Graphics类Graphics类是所有图形上下文的抽象基类,它允许应用程序在组件以及闭屏图像上进行绘制。Graphics类封装了Java支持的基本绘图操作所需的状态信息,主要包括颜色、字体、画笔、文本、图像等Graphics类提供了绘图常用的方法,利用这些方法可以实现直线、
转载 2023-05-22 23:09:05
242阅读
从历史记录上的整体反馈,这款软件能够比较全面的帮助使用者达成自己的目的,这在很早之前的版本更迭中就可以做到,在后续的版本更迭中更有了比较好的优化,可以有更多的惊喜,非常值得下载。java画图板工具官方版是款由java写的画图工具,java画图板工具比起windows自带的画图工具来说功能更强大,界面更简洁。java画图板工具中还允许用户记录他们正在绘制的内容或文字。这对于一些学校或者是教程制作的用
转载 2023-05-29 16:08:56
205阅读
函数的定义:定义在类中的具有特定功能的一段独立小程序。也称之位 方法函数里边只能调用函数,不能定义函数函数只是提高代码复用性方式体现之一。函数的格式:修饰符 返回值类型  韩树明(参数类型 形式参数1,参数类型 形式参数2,....){ 执行语句; return 返回值;}   如果你需要一个功能,那么也需要定义一段独立的代码来表示。&n
转载 2023-09-27 19:37:57
74阅读
Java 实现画图,具体实现画直线、曲线、矩形以及圆。代码架构为MVC模式 分为三大部分: 1.domain(实现继承抽象类DrawObject来画出不同图形的具体操作) 以画直线为例:import java.awt.geom.Line2D; import common.DrawObject; public class DrawLine extends DrawObject{
转载 2023-05-31 09:50:11
225阅读
Java中绘制基本图形,可以使用Java类库中的Graphics类,此类位于​​java​​​.awt包中。在我们自己的java程序文件中,要使用Graphics类就需要使用​​import java.awt.Graphics​​语句将Graphics类导入进来。
转载 2022-06-30 09:10:00
330阅读
实现了简单的电脑画图软件,代码如下: import java.awt.BasicStroke; import java.awt.BorderLayout; import java.awt.CardLayout; import java.awt.Color; import java.awt.Cursor; import java.awt.Dialog; import java.awt.Dimen
转载 2023-08-28 14:21:24
67阅读
图像是由一组像素构成,用二进制形式保存的图片。java语言支持GIF、JPEG和BMP这3种主要图像文件格式。java语言的图像处理功能被封装在Image类中。图像载入和输出在java程序中,图像也是对象,所以载入图像时,先要声明Image对象,然后,利用getImage()方法把Image对象与图像文件联系起来。载入图像文件的方法有两个:Image getImage(URL url),url指明
1.设计思路首先我直接去了Windows自带画图程序去实践模拟,看看具体方法,进行了布局和按钮的思考。容器顶层放工具栏,工具栏中存放图形按钮、工具按钮、颜色按钮。对于图形按钮,存放在垂直的Box中,分成行列,设置边框,设置标签,加入JToolbar;对于工具按钮设置Jpanel保存,线条粗细设置垂直Box存储,设置边框后,最后将两者加入水平Box中,与前面图形按钮设置间隔加入JToolbar中,设
# 教程:如何使用Java画图 ## 简介 本教程将教会你如何使用Java编程语言来画图。无论你是刚入行的新手还是经验丰富的开发者,本教程都将帮助你理解整个过程,并提供每一步所需的代码和注释。在本教程中,我们将使用Java的图形库来创建图形化界面,并使用绘图函数来实现画图功能。 ## 整体流程 以下是实现“Java画图”的整体步骤的流程图: ```flow st=>start: 开始 op
原创 2023-08-05 12:42:01
66阅读
# Java 画图 画图在计算机编程中是一个非常常见的任务,无论是绘制简单的几何图形,还是创建复杂的图形界面,Java都提供了丰富的绘图功能。本文将介绍Java中如何使用绘图API进行画图,包括绘制基本图形、自定义图形和使用图形库。 ## 1. 绘制基本图形 Java提供了一个名为`Graphics`的类,用于绘制基本图形。我们可以通过在继承`JPanel`的自定义组件中重写`paintCo
原创 2023-11-19 13:08:15
144阅读
BufferedImage是Image的一个子类,跟它一样,Image,ImageIO,Icon,ImageIcon都是java中的类,BufferedImage的主要作用就是将一副图片加载到内存中。BufferedImage生成的图片在内存里有一个图像缓冲区,利用这个缓冲区我们可以操作这个图片,通常用来做图片修改操作如大小变换、图片变灰、设置图片透明或不透明等。而Graphics2D 是Grap
转载 2023-08-14 18:12:25
182阅读
  • 1
  • 2
  • 3
  • 4
  • 5